Can South Africans study nursing in Australia and how much would they have to pay?


Can South Africans study nursing in Australia and how much would they have to pay?

G'day,

Everyone can study nursing in Australia as long as they have good English proficiency since they need to communicate very well with their colleagues and patients. Also nowadays there are shortage of available places for nursing courses in Australian universities, since there are so many ppl wants to be nurse now.

There are only 42 (soon to be 43) universities in Australia, all of them are fully accredited and they are tightly regulated, therefore the quality and recognition of their graduates are equal from wherever university you are studying from. The most important thing is you have to READ the course information carefully, since some courses may have the same name but different content.

I suggest you to go to Dept of Education, Science and Technology (http://cricos.dest.gov.au) and IDP Education Australia website (www.idp.edu.au) online databases. It can tell you the universities offering nursing courses to international students and the website. Please make sure that you access the information for international students, since some requirements, application form and fees are different than Australians'.

Once decided on the uni, fill in the application form and send it together with certified copy of your academic qualification. Depending on your country of origin, you may also need to submit an IELTS test results for proof of your English proficiency (www.ielts.org)
